702, named after the area code of their hometown of Las Vegas, Nevada, is an American platinum-selling female hip-hop and R&B; trio. They were discovered by Michael Bivins of New Edition, and made their recorded debut on Subway's hit single "This Lil' Game We Play." Missy Elliott crafted four songs from their first album No Doubt, including "Steelo", and two more songs for their second, self-titled album, including "Where My Girls At".
